As you might know, three of our friends are in prison. Previously, we announced that Esra Mungan is under solitary confinement. Yesterday, Esra Mungan was taken to another cell which is smaller, filthier, and stuffier for no valid reason. Also, Muzaffer Kaya and Kıvanç Ersoy were transferred to the Silivri Prison yesterday. One of our lawyers from Academics for Peace today visited the Silivri Prison. She told us that Muzaffer Kaya and Kıvanç Ersoy sent their best regards to everyone. They say that they are strictly segregated, they stay alone in the cells for three people, they are not allowed to see each other or any others; all their books were taken from them with the promise that they would be given back later, their rooms are completely empty except for a pen and a notebook, they were searched naked when they were first taken to Silivri and kept naked for twenty minutes which is an utterly dishonoring situation, and that their first request is to stay together in the same cell." Our friends have been sending their messages of struggle since the first day they were detained. Their captivity conditions could not overcome their strength and their insistence to raise their cry for peace. Now, in response to their resistance, more degrading and inhuman conditions are being imposed on our friends. We demand the immediate cessation of this degrading treatment and the release of our friends. We would like to let everyone know about this situation and encourage all to spread the information throughout national and international media and institutions. This situation is unacceptable.
